hi first of all i thanks all the developers of different mods you guys are doing a great job and also the one who make ckan you make our live easy :D i want to say some mods are working great on 1.2.2 (if manually installed) but ckan says it is incompatible why this happen any idea.:blush:

Because there is both a "minimum" required KSP version and a "maximum" version supported in the listing. I believe these default to the same value.

I've seen some authors future-proof their listings by stating their max version is 1.X.99, but that is a gamble.

Instead of manually installing mods, you can force ckan to install them if deemed "incompatible" using the CLI: https://github.com/KSP-CKAN/CKAN/wiki/User-guide#using-the-cli & https://github.com/KSP-CKAN/CKAN/issues/881#issuecomment-104538090

Pro: if the mod gets updated, CKAN will automatically manage it in future (it would list, but not update manually installed mods AFAIK)

Con: you have to get the package name from the GUI first and also would have to care yourself for any dependencies in the same way.

@Hupf is mostly right. But the most recent release of the CKAN client includes some functionality in the GUI to extend which KSP versions to deem compatible with the current one. It doesn't seem to be very well documented in the wiki yet though.

Make sure you're running the most recent release, version 1.22.1, from https://github.com/KSP-CKAN/CKAN/releases . Then you can go to the Settings menu and select "Compatible KSP versions". From that dialogue, you can elect to also install mods that are marked as compatible with KSP 1.2.1 and 1.2 as well as the current 1.2.2, for example.

Note that a mod can opt out of that, and specify that it definitely should only be installed on a specific version. And, obviously, if you install a mod in a potentially incompatible version and everything breaks, you get to keep both pieces.
